Stainless steel pleated filters cartridge is a type of filter element that is made from stainless steel and designed with a pleated structure. The pleats increase the surface area of the filter, which provides more capacity for capturing contaminants. Stainless steel pleated filter cartridge is known for their high strength, durability, and resistance to heat and corrosion. They are commonly used in industrial applications where high-performance filters are required for filtering fluids and gases. parameters Material:stainless steel304, 304L, 304HC, 316, 316L, 321, 430 or as per you request. The check valve is a kind of one-way valve, which relies on the pressure of the medium to realize the metal seal between the spool and the valve body, the greater the medium pressure, the better the sealing performance. The check valve design and manufacture of APImeivalve fully meet the requirements of API spec 6A and can be used interchangeably with equipment conforming to API spec 6A. The valve body is made of alloy steel forging, with strong mechanical properties, and can withstand high pressure, with safe and reliable performance. The bonnet and valve body are bolted together, and the seal is the sealing ring on the bonnet and the inner wall of the valve body. The sealing performance is reliable. It provides minimal assembly clearance between the bonnet and body (designed to be 0), thereby reducing erosion of bolts and holes by corrosive media and reducing bolt loads. Hard alloy is hard-faced on the core and sealing surface of the valve body so that it has good wear resistance and corrosion resistance. The core material should use sulfur-proof steel, and other parts should use the method of limiting hardness so that the valve can be used in an environment containing H2S. Install the valve body into the pipeline according to the flow direction on the valve body. The valve core by the upper and lower pressure to achieve movement and sealing so that the valve core can not be stuck. Technical Parameters 1. One-way flow of the working medium. 2. Product Description Honeycomb Activated Carbon Honeycomb activated carbon is a type of activated carbon that is structured in a honeycomb shape. It is commonly used in air and water purification due to its high surface area and pore volume, which allows it to effectively adsorb impurities and pollutants. The honeycomb structure also provides excellent flow characteristics, making it ideal for use in filtration systems. https://www.recarburizers.com/products/coal-based-honeycomb-activated.html Features Honeycomb activated carbon is a type of activated carbon that has a unique honeycomb-like structure, with a high surface area and porosity. Its features include: High surface area: Honeycomb activated carbon has a high surface area that allows it to adsorb a wide range of impurities. Low pressure drop: Its unique structure provides low pressure drop, which makes it ideal for applications with high flow rates. High adsorption capacity: Honeycomb activated carbon has a high adsorption capacity for a wide range of contaminants, including volatile organic compounds (VOCs), odors, and gases. Regenerable: It can be regenerated by heating it to high temperatures and reused, making it a cost-effective option. Some common applications of honeycomb activated carbon include: Air purification: It can be used to remove VOCs, odors, and other air pollutants from indoor and outdoor environments. Water treatment: It can be used for the removal of organic and inorganic contaminants, as well as taste and odor control in drinking water. Gas purification: It can be used to purify gases, such as natural gas and biogas. Catalyst support: It can be used as a support material for catalysts in chemical and petrochemical processes.

Introduction Bentonite Mat are consisting of three different layers supported by geotextiles and/or geomembranes, mechanically held together by needling, stitching, or chemical adhesives. A Bentonite Mat construction would consist of two layers of Bentonite Mat stitched together enclosing a layer of natural or processed sodium bentonite. The engineering function of a Bentonite Mat is containment as a hydraulic barrier to water, leachate or other liquids and sometimes gases. Typical Applications Includes Ponds and stormwater impoundments: Bentonite Mat are widely implied in sewage reservoir, storage ponds, and regular reservoir. The Bentonite Mat does not require specialized machine nor skilled workers, which makes it a great material for ecological pool protection. Landfill liner : Bentonite Mat can replace the clay layer of geosynthetic membrane compound system, offering less systematic leakage rate. For a better result,combining with geosynthetic membrane is recommended. By doing so, when the geomembrane is compromised, the Bentonite Mat can still work for its purpose. Anti-leakage of gas or oil depot:Due to the ease of application and great toughness, it is the most economic and reliable choice of leakage protection for oil or gas depot. Landfill cap: Using the Bentonite Mat are widely adopted in different countries, for the damage and crack effect of uneven subsidence, desiccations, and dampness are drastically less than ordinary clay layer. Hence, the Bentonite Mat are extraordinary suitable for landfill cap. Underground project waterproofing: The protruding thin fibers of Bentonite Mat surface can lodge in concrete and served as an anchor. When the subsidence occurs, the small anchors would prevent the Bentonite Mat and structure from forming a water intrusion interface.

Saving investment Based on the features of light expanded clay aggregate (leca), double-cylinder insert type rotary kiln controls the preheating and calcination process. The energy-saving vertical preheater is equipped in leca production line with advanced process, and reasonable design and high level technology. Production technology Light expanded clay aggregate production line, when the raw material is clay or slurry, the production flow chart shall be consist of raw material process, mixing, granulating, insert type rotary kiln burning process, cooling process, screening and bag packing. When the raw material is shale, the production flow chart shall be consist of crushing, screening, single rotary kiln burning process, cooling process, screening and bag packing. The fuel could be coal, nature gas, biomass fuel.

Here are the key points about food grade microcrystalline wax: Composition: Refined from petroleum, it is a mixture of straight-chain saturated hydrocarbons primarily in the C30-C50 range. Properties: Solid at room temperature, melts between 135-145�°F to a clear colorless liquid. Hydrophobic. Applications: Used as a component in foods like cheeses, meats, desserts where it migrates to the surface to form a moisture/gas barrier. Also in confectionery coatings, chewing gum bases, pharmaceutical tablets. Regulations: Must meet FDA food additive regulations in 21 CFR 172.886. Limited amounts of PAHs, heavy metals and other contaminants. Processing: Can be mixed into formulations as a binder and film former. Sets to a glossy, tasteless/odorless protective coating. Benefits: Provides effective moisture and grease resistance. Insoluble and non-digestible if ingested. Safety: Generally recognized as safe for indirect food use due to its fatty acid composition and resistance to absorption. Alternatives: Natural waxes with similar properties but microcrystalline wax is very affordable for its performance. So in summary, it is a versatile petroleum-derived wax for numerous moisture barrier applications in foods and supplements.
Polypropylene (PP) Sheet Polypropylene is one of the low-priced polymers. Polypropylene is distinguished from other thermoplastics by its superiority in mechanical, thermal, electrical, physical and chemical properties. It has very good resistance to acids, organic solvents, alkalines and electrolytes, has a low moisture absorption rate, and has a light and easy to process feature. Although the water vapor barrier property of polypropylene is good, its gas and aroma permeability property is mediocre. It is a better barrier against animal fats compared to polyethylene. It can be used up to 140�°C. General Features of Polypropylene: Being light High strength Resistance to impact and compression Resistance to many alkalis and acids No toxins No staining Having hardness and flexibility Low moisture absorbency Easy to process and high heat resistance Polypropylene is a low density resin, naturally translucent and milky white in color. It also has a high dyeing ability. It is strengthened with glass fiber and has the desired chemical, thermal and electrical properties. Usage Areas of Polypropylene: Chemical resistance tanks, liners, handrails, walkways, toilet equipment, household appliances, sinks, veneer consoles, cleaning room walls, floors and ceilings, thermoforming products, coated barrels and drums, pump parts and casings.

Physical Properties NMP is colorless transparent oily liquid, slightly amine odor, can be dissolved in most organic and inorganic compounds, polar gases, natural and synthetic polymer compounds . Acute toxicity: mice oral channel LC50:5130mg/kg; Rat oral meridian LD50:3914mg/kg NMP is stable in a neutral solution. After 8 hours in 4% sodium hydroxide solution,there are 50%~70% of NMP that will occurs hydrolysis . Uses in Different Fields NMP can be used as solvent for polymer reaction; Compared with phenol and furfural, n-methylpiriolanone has the characteristics of strong polarity, non-toxic and non-corrosive, and easy recovery. It has been used to remove aromatic substances in lubricating oil instead of phenol and aldehyde. This process is safe and easy to operate with low solvent loss; NMP can be used to recover acetylene, butadiene and vallediene from naphtha cracking gas. NMP can be used to clean blockades in chemical equipment of tower type. High concentration of N-methylpyrsquidone can also be used as ultrasonic cleaning agent for fine machinery and optical instruments; NMP is the main raw material for the production of artificial plasma and vitamin B1.
